Clear Creek Backpack March/April 2022

When Sumi told me she had an extra spot on her permit, I jumped at the chance to join her six day backpacking trip to Clear Creek. I had never been to Clear Creek and this sounded like a fantastic trip (especially for late March/early April before it gets too hot). This was our itinerary:

Day 1: South Kaibab to Sumner Wash (Clear Creek Trail), ~ 9.5 miles, 4700’ elevation loss/1250’ elevation gain
Day 2: Sumner Wash to Clear Creek campsite, 6.7 miles, ~1200’ elevation gain/1350’ elevation loss (cumulative accounting for the ups and downs)
Day 3: Day hike to Cheyava Falls, 10 miles, ~1300’ elevation gain/loss
Day 4: Clear Creek campsite to Bright Angel Campground, 8.7 miles, 1350’ elevation gain/2450’ elevation loss
Day 5: Day hike to Ribbon Falls, 12 miles, 1240 feet elevation gain/loss
Day 6: Bright Angel Campground to Bright Angel trailhead, 9.5 miles, 4400 feet elevation gain

Overall the trip was terrific. We had nice weather, good company, and gorgeous scenery. Ribbon Falls was a lovely oasis and Cheyava Falls lived up to its name, which means “intermittent river” in Hopi. Dry or not, it was still a nice day exploring Clear Creek Canyon (minus all the yucca stabs). The solitude was a nice respite from the hive of activity at Phantom Ranch (although I certainly appreciated the Arnold Palmers and $1 refills!). I haven't backpacked the canyon since moving here in 2019 - so it was nice to be in the backcountry again. Awesome trip!
